Title of article :
Effect of microwave irradiation on crystalline structure and dielectric property of PVDF/PZT composite

Abstract :
The crystalline structure change and dielectric performance of microwave-irradiated PVDF/PZT composites were studied by FTIR, DSC, DMTA, and DEA. The dielectric analysis suggests that the dielectric permissivity and loss reduce, which is useful for improving the sensitivity of composites used in passive transducers. The structure analysis results show that the microwave irradiation promotes crystalline transformation of PVDF from a to b; The crystallinity of PVDF in PVDF/PZT composites increases and DT decreases; the DMTA measurements illustrate that the value of E0 and tand peak increases after irradiation
